Key Responsibilities
» Perform servicing, maintenance, and repair work on forklifts and other material-handling equipment
» Diagnose m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ical faults
» Complete accurate job cards, service reports, and timesheets
» Maintain safety, compliance, and presentation of your vehicle and tools
» Communicate clearly with customers and the coordination team

» Identify parts requirements and assist with quotations or additional work recommendations
